Penicillium marneffei infection presenting as an immune reconstitution inflammatory syndrome in an HIV patient.
International journal of STD & AIDS - 1 Nov 2010
Ho A, Shankland G S, Seaton R A
Abstract excerpt
We describe a case of Penicillium marneffei infection acquired in Thailand, manifesting as an immune reconstitution inflammatory syndrome (IRIS) in a Caucasian man with advanced HIV-related immunosuppression (CD4 72 cells/mm³). Initial presentation was consistent with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ia, and empirical co-trimoxazole resulted in clinical improvement. One month after initiating antiretroviral therapy...
